ビット演算での考察 [第01局目]

まずは石の並びを定義します。

黒石のビットを入力してください。
00000 00110 01010 01100 00000
白石のビットを入力してください。
01111 11001 10101 10011 11110
┌○○○○
○○●●○
○●○●○
○●●○○
○○○○┘

上記の石の並びのbit表現
bs <- 黒石 (BlackStone)
ws <- 白石 (WhiteStone)

bs:
 00000 00110 01010 01100 00000
ws:
 01111 11001 10101 10011 11110

上記の bit を元に色々な計算式と結果を書き残したいと思います。
基本的なパターンと、その逆のパターンを寄せ集める事により、複雑なパターンを構築できるはずだと思うので、時間はあまりないけど地道に頑張ろう。。